Reading Comprehension

Reading comprehension is an essential skill that enables learners to understand written texts in the target language. To improve reading comprehension, learners can follow these tips:

  1. Start with simpler texts: Begin with materials that are slightly below your current proficiency level. This will help you build confidence and gradually progress to more complex texts.

  2. Use context clues: Pay attention to the surrounding words and sentences to infer the meaning of unfamiliar words. This will enhance your understanding of the overall text.

  3. Practice active reading: Engage with the text by highlighting key points, taking notes, and summarizing the main ideas. This active approach will improve your comprehension and retention.

  4. Expand vocabulary: Regularly learn new words and phrases to expand your vocabulary. This will enable you to understand a wider range of texts and express yourself more effectively.

Listening Skills

Listening skills are crucial for effective communication and language learning. To enhance your listening skills, consider the following techniques:

  1. Listen to authentic materials: Expose yourself to native speakers by listening to podcasts, audiobooks, or radio shows in the target language. This will help you become familiar with natural speech patterns and accents.

  2. Practice active listening: Focus on understanding the main ideas, key details, and the speaker’s tone. Take notes while listening and summarize what you have heard to reinforce your comprehension.

  3. Use subtitles: Start by watching movies or TV shows with subtitles in your native language, then gradually switch to subtitles in the target language. This will help you associate spoken words with their written forms.

  4. Engage in conversations: Regularly participate in conversations with native speakers or language exchange partners. This will improve your listening skills and provide opportunities to practice speaking.

Writing Proficiency

Writing proficiency is essential for effective communication and language learning. To enhance your writing skills, consider the following techniques:

  1. Practice regularly: Set aside dedicated time for writing practice. Start with simple exercises, such as writing short paragraphs or journal entries, and gradually progress to more complex tasks.

  2. Seek feedback: Share your written work with native speakers or language teachers and ask for feedback. This will help you identify areas for improvement and learn from your mistakes.

  3. Read and analyze texts: Read texts in the target language and analyze the writing style, grammar structures, and vocabulary used. This will expand your knowledge and improve your writing skills.

  4. Use writing prompts: Utilize writing prompts or topics to guide your writing practice. This will help you focus on specific areas and develop your writing skills in a structured manner.
